        AN ACT to authorize the Legal Aid Society of Northeastern  New  York  to
          retroactively  apply  for  a  real  property tax exemption for certain
          properties in the city of Saratoga Springs
          The People of the State of New York, represented in Senate and  Assem-
        bly, do enact as follows:
     1    Section 1. Notwithstanding any other provision of law to the contrary,
     2  the  assessor  of  the  city of Saratoga Springs is hereby authorized to
     3  accept from the Legal Aid Society of Northeastern New York  an  applica-
     4  tion for exemption from real property taxes pursuant to section 420-a of
     5  the  real  property  tax law for the 2014 assessment roll for the parcel
     6  owned by such not-for-profit association which  is  located  at  40  New
     7  Street,  in  the  city  of  Saratoga  Springs,  county of Saratoga.   If
     8  accepted, the application shall be reviewed as if it had  been  received
     9  on or before the taxable status date established for such roll.
    10    If satisfied that such  not-for-profit organization would otherwise be
    11  entitled to such exemption if such not-for-profit organization had filed
    12  applications  or  renewal applications for exemptions by the appropriate
    13  taxable status date, the assessor, upon approval by the Saratoga Springs
    14  city council, may make appropriate correction to the  subject  roll.  If
    15  such  exemption  is granted and such organization, therefore, shall have
    16  paid any taxes with respect to the subject roll, the applicable  govern-
    17  ing  body or tax department may, in its sole discretion, provide for the
    18  refund of those taxes paid and cancel  those  taxes,  fines,  penalties,
    19  liens, or interest remaining unpaid.
    20    § 2. This act shall take effect immediately.
